Depression can affect many aspects of your daily life, but your diet can significantly influence your mood and overall well-being.

Let's dive into 5 superfoods that can support mental health and help manage depression symptoms effectively.

Rich in omega-3 fatty acids, fatty fish like salmon and sardines support brain function and reduce inflammation, which can help alleviate symptoms of depression.

Packed with omega-3s and antioxidants, walnuts promote brain health and help reduce anxiety and depression symptoms.

Leafy greens like spinach are full of folate, a nutrient that has been linked to improved mood and lower risk of depression.

Curcumin, the active compound in turmeric, has anti-inflammatory properties and can help increase serotonin levels, easing symptoms of depression.

Rich in antioxidants and serotonin-boosting compounds, dark chocolate can enhance mood and help reduce stress and anxiety.
